
About this Dog
Looking Glass Animal Rescue is a 501(c)(3) virtual rescue, using a network of dedicated fosters throughout Louisiana and the Northeast to care for our animals until adoption. You may be required to travel if approved for adoption. Meet Luna! This little girl has been through a lot but has come out the other side - and she's an absolute doll! Luna was found with an injury to her eye due to a BB lodged near it. She was immediately cared for, the BB removed surgically, and though blind in her right eye, nothing slows her down! She was timid when she first came to us, but now she is much more outgoing, extremely playful with the other dogs in the home - both large and small, extremely affectionate with the children in the home, has good indoor manners - house broken, crate trained - though she'd prefer a bed at the foot of yours instead! Luna's favorite pass time is sneaking off to her bed with toys, slippers, socks - not to chew, just her way of having her people closer. She's truly a wonderful girl, two years of age, smaller than your usual lab mix at 38-40 pounds, and ready for a home of her own!
